 I just wanted to share with everyone a truly awesome book that I have read recently:  Prisoners in the Palace:  How Victoria Became Queen with the Help of Her Maid, a Reporter, and a Scoundrel.  A Novel of Intrigue and Romance. by Michaela MacColl

Prisoners of the Palace

For those of you who like historical fiction, this book is for you.  The book centers around the intrigue of Princess Victoria inheriting the throne of Great Britain.  It is told from the perspective of a young woman, tragically and suddenly orphaned, who has to change status from that of a member of the gentry to a servant - a maid for Princess Victoria.  Both girls are in their late teens and are having to learn to deal with the life they have been given.  When Liza, the unexpected maid, finds a plot set up to keep Victoria from inheriting the throne, she makes it her mission to help and endear herself to the young princess.  With the help of a quick-witted street urchin that has made his home in the palace and a young newspaperman determined to make his way in the world, they will do whatever they can to help Victoria secure her rightful place as Queen of Great Britain.

I can't say enough about this book. This book is going to be one of those that transcends time and even future generations will enjoy.
